Your unpaid invoices aren't just a to-do list. They're a live signal of your future cash flow — if you can read them.
What if the messiest, least predictable part of your finances — when customers actually pay — became the most accurate number in your forecast?
Your accounts are a window into your future cash, not just a record of the past. When customers pay, how reliably, and who's drifting late all shape whether you can make payroll, invest, or ride out a slow month. The old way of forecasting — last year's patterns plus a gut feel — can't keep up. AI reads the real data in real time: it spots which customers will pay on time, which need a nudge, and which are heading toward default. That turns a hopeful estimate into a dynamic forecast that updates as behaviour changes, so you're planning from what's likely to happen, not what you hope will.



Cash-flow forecasting has always been part maths, part crystal ball. AI takes the guesswork out — turning your invoices into a reliable read on the months ahead.
Old-school forecasting leans on last year's numbers and a hopeful guess. AI reads real payment behaviour and predicts what's actually coming.
